TEX33, or Testis Expressed 33, is a protein that, as indicated by its name, has been identified as being expressed in the testis. The gene encoding TEX33 belongs to a category of genes that are often identified by their restricted expression patterns, suggesting a specialized role in testicular function and possibly in spermatogenesis, which is the process of sperm cell development.
The TEX33 protein is presumed to have a role in the intricate cellular processes that occur within the testes, such as cell division, meiosis, and the formation of spermatozoa. While the specific function of TEX33 has not been fully elucidated, proteins that are expressed in the testis and during spermatogenesis are often involved in chromatin remodeling, genetic imprinting, or the regulation of gene expression specific to the development of gametes.Exploration of TEX33 may reveal a connection to male fertility and reproductive biology. The study of TEX33 typically involves examining its expression pattern at various stages of spermatogenesis, identifying interacting proteins, and determining its subcellular localization within testicular cells. Such research might include the use of knockout models to study the phenotypic consequences of the absence of TEX33 and gain insights into its role in male fertility.
